There are still some major misconceptions about strength training exercise and the effects it can have on your body. Some fundamentals of this very old and basic form of exercise have been drowned in the mass of misinformation that exists. It seems everyone is looking for a quick fix or magic instant solution for their weight and health problems but the short answer to this is - there is none. For decades the general public has been advised that 'cardio' type activity is the key to losing fat weight. The common prescription for 'weight loss' is walking, running or other endurance type activities. But we now know that these types of exercise alone are not sufficient for consistent fat loss that leads to a strong, lean healthy body. They do not address the number one problem that leads to a slowed metabolism (the body's engine) which is the main contributor to ongoing weight gain - loss of muscle tissue. Body composition is the measure of how much body fat you have in relation to how much lean muscle tissue you have (your muscle/fat ratio). Obviously you want less body fat and more toned muscle but endurance type exercise will not contribute to rebuilding and re-toning muscle tissue. The most effective weight loss program is based mainly on strength training exercise as it is the best way to change body composition. This gets the body burning more fuel (calories) around the clock which is how you achieve long-term weight management along with good health. The key to a healthy metabolism is so much more than battling the bathroom scale it is about healthy toned muscle which is the basis of a healthy functioning metabolism. If your muscles have become weakened from a lack of strengthening exercise it will be hard to control your weight as you do not simply have the capacity to burn lots of fuel and the body will then store excess as body fat. As we get older we are also fighting against an age-induced back slide in body composition. At around age 25 the body starts breaking down muscle tissue - that is unless it is being used constantly. So even if you maintain the same weight on the scales your body composition is changing. It is necessary to strength train just to maintain that muscle tissue otherwise you will lose the calorie burning and metabolism boosting affects of that tissue. Many people think their metabolism is slowing down and this has become a favorite excuse for weight gain. "Its not my fault I am gaining weight, my metabolism has slowed down". Yet the reality is exactly the opposite. People are not getting fatter because their metabolisms have slowed down. Their metabolisms have slowed down because they are getting fatter. So if a healthy functioning metabolism is your goal whether for weight loss or simply good health and longevity your strength training program is your number one best friend as it will give you all this and much, much more.
